Imagine this: in 36 hours you and your team have to travel as far away as possible from where you live without spending even a penny of your own money. All that while competing with hundreds of other student teams from all over the country who are trying to beat you. Sounds like a challenge! And sounds like lots of fun, too! 

Jailbreak 2017 is the name of this crazy UK-wide 36 hour race that we are privileged to take part in. It will be a once in a lifetime experience. But actually it is about way more than that. 

Jailbreak wants to raise awareness and most importantly raise funds for Newlife, a charity society that supports children with disabilities in the UK, e.g. providing them with special seating or walking and standing aids. 

And exactly this is the main goal of the whole event. Each Jailbreak team has committed themselves to raise a minimum of 120 £ for Newlife. Every single penny we raise on justgiving.com will be instantly sent to them. There’s no intermediate agent so you don’t have to worry about where your money ends up!

About the charity

Newlife puts disabled and terminally ill children at the heart of everything it does, providing a range of practical support services to families across the UK. For more information, visit www.newlifecharity.co.uk.
